NFL Football Roundup of on-line stories

NFL Weekly.com reports on Ben Roethlisberger’s progress. It appears positive.

NFL.com has a report on the preseason for the Pittsburgh Steelers.

Yahoo’s Fantasy Sports looks into taking a running back in the first round fantasy draft and then avoiding drafting a back for several rounds.

ESPN leads with a possible replacement for Paul Tagliabue, that being his assistant Roger Goodell. Typical of ESPN these days, the article is a teaser, you have to pay to get the rest.

CBS Sportsline leads with an article on the Philadelphia Eagles opening training camp, but when you read the article it is a great list of top 10 NFL questions going into the season.

Finally, Fox Sports leads with an article on Super Bowl XLI in Miami next Feb. 4, 2007. It discusses the random drawing for tickets and how to get involved. A must read if you are planning on going. It also has a cool live timer telling you how many days, hours, minutes, and seconds until the Super Bowl.
